In mathematics, the secant function (often abbreviated as sec) is a trigonometric function that is the reciprocal of the cosine function. The secant function is defined for all real numbers except for values where cosine is equal to zero.

Here are the steps to determine the secant values for a given angle:

1. Identify the angle for which you want to find the secant value.
2. Use a calculator or trigonometric tables (if available) to find the cosine value of the angle.
3. Take the reciprocal of the cosine value to find the secant value.

For example, if you want to find the sec y value for y = 30 degrees:

1. y = 30 degrees.
2. Use a calculator or trigonometric tables to find the cosine value of 30 degrees, which is approximately 0.866.
3. Take the reciprocal of 0.866 to find the secant value, which is approximately 1.154.

So, the sec y value for y = 30 degrees is approximately 1.154.
